JUDGMENT 1 COMMISSIONER: This is an appeal pursuant to s 40 of the Valuation of Land Act 1916 (the Act) against the statutory valuation (as at the base date of 1 July 2004) for a property at 34 Gloucester Street, Nelson Bay – being Lots 1 and 2 in Strata Plan 43037 (the site). The site has a frontage to Gloucester Street on its southern boundary and a fall both slightly across the block and, in a somewhat more pronounced fashion, from the south to the north to its frontage to a waterfront reserve.
2 The statutory valuation against which the appeal is made is an amended statutory valuation, the Valuer General having allowed, to a limited extent, an earlier objection. That amended statutory valuation is in the sum of $1,050,000 as at the base date.
